Taco 'Bout a Tough Stance: Trump and Immigration Reform

From the start of his presidency, Donald Trump has made his position on immigration reform crystal clear. He's vowed to build a wall on the southern border, crack down on illegal immigration, and prioritize enforcing existing regulations. Trump's hardline stance has been criticized by many, with some arguing that it's inhumane while others claim it's indispensable to protect national security and sovereignty. The debate over immigration reform in the U.S. is complex and deeply divided, and Trump's approach has certainly added fuel to the dispute.

His administration has implemented a number of policies aimed at limiting illegal immigration, including a travel ban on citizens from several Muslim-majority countries, stricter enforcement of visa rules, and deportation of undocumented immigrants. Trump's supporters argue that these measures are successful in deterring illegal immigration and keeping the country safe. However, critics contend that they targetedly affect vulnerable populations and infringe upon fundamental human rights.

The long-term impact of his policies on U.S. society and the lives of millions of immigrants remains to be seen.
